Public bug reported: Quite regularly the graphics driver does not load on boot and I am stuck with a purple screen. Grub shows fine but when I select Ubuntu I get the purple screen. On a succesfull boot the purple screen disappears and I see the runscripts (I removed 'quiet splash' from the boot options'), but sometimes the screen merely flickers and stays purple. However the system is still responsive, I can use Alt+SysReq+REISUB to reboot and I can even ssh to my machine.
My machine is a samsung-305u1 (with a AMD Fusion E-350) and I use the open source drivers. According to http://ubuntuforums.org/showthread.php?t=2012657 the problem can also occur on nvidia machines, and by typing the following commands in the grub commandline the system boots fine: test continue videoinfo normal Setting 'nomodeset' also seems to work but this boots my machine to unity 2d. The problem seems to occur quite randomly, but by doing the next steps I can reproduce the problem 4 out of 5 times: 1. Boot normally 2. Connect external monitor with larger resolution 3. Close the lid of the laptop ( i guess this turns of the laptop screen) 4. Shutdown 5.
